The secret to that irresistible crunch lies in the batter. A combination of flour and cornmeal creates the perfect texture, with the cornmeal adding bold crispness and the flour helping the coating cling beautifully to the shrimp. This duo produces a crust that fries up light, crunchy, and full of character.
Flavor is built right into the coating with a blend of onion powder, garlic powder, kosher salt, and a touch of cayenne pepper for gentle heat. The ingredient list may be short, but every component pulls its weight, resulting in fried shrimp that are crispy on the outside, tender inside, and packed with flavor in every bite.
